MidCamp 2025 Last Chance Session Proposal Workshop

The MidCamp 2025 Last Chance Session Proposal Workshop, an online event led by Aaron Feledy, will be held on January 7, 2025, from 3:00 PM to 4:00 PM CST via Zoom. This interactive session is designed to help participants craft compelling proposals for MidCamp 2025. Interested attendees can join the #speakers channel on MidCamp Slack to participate.

A view of the new Drupal CMS, and free consulting

"A View of the New Drupal CMS and Free Consulting," an online event, will be held on January 7, 2025, from 3:30 AM to 5:00 AM IST. The session, conducted in Spanglish, offers an introduction to the upcoming Drupal CMS launch and includes a space for free consultation. Participants can engage through Twitch chat or submit questions using #PreguntaDrupaleada or #DrupaleadaQuestion on social media.

Pacific Time - Virtual Drupal Meetup

The Pacific Time Virtual Drupal Meetup, a recurring online event for Drupal enthusiasts, will take place on January 8, 2025, from 6:00 PM to 8:00 PM PST. The meetup includes introductions for newcomers, presentations, discussions, and networking opportunities for participants from any time zone. Attendees are encouraged to RSVP via Eventbrite and adhere to the Drupal community’s code of conduct.

MidCamp 2025 Planning

MidCamp 2025 Planning, a virtual meetup for organizing the annual Drupal-focused event, is scheduled for January 9, 2025, from 3:00 PM to 4:00 PM CST on MidCamp Slack. The session invites participants with diverse skills and interests to contribute to the planning process, regardless of their location. Interested individuals can join the #midcamp-organizers channel on the MidCamp Slack team to get involved.
